The purpose of study was to determine the effect of pulmonary function of university tennis players(n=6 Smoker group and n=6 Non-smoker group).<BR> The results obtained from the experiment were as follows.<BR> 1. FVC appeared in order of smoker group(4.51±0.3 ℓ), non-smoker group(5.05±0.2 ℓ).<BR> 2. FEV1 appeared in order of smoker group(3.88±0.8㎖), non-smoker group(4.40±0.4 ㎖).<BR> 3. FEV1/FVC appeared in order of smoker group(86.25±15.4%), non-smoker group(91.25±9.4%).<BR> 4. FEF25%-75% appeared in order of smoker group(4.06±1.4 ℓ), non-smoker group(4.98±1.1 ℓ).<BR> 5. MVV appeared in order of smoker group(133.67±34.5 ℓ), non-smoker group (172.95±23.4 ℓ).<BR> 6. VC appeared in order of smoker group(4.80±0.4 ℓ), non-smoker group(5.59±0.3 ℓ).<BR> 7. TLC appeared in order of smoker group(6.59±0.6 ℓ), non-smoker group(7.82±1.1 ℓ).<BR> 8. RV appeared in order of smoker group(1.79±0.6 ℓ), non-smoker group(2.23±1.0 ℓ).<BR> 9. FRC appeared in order of smoker group(3.59±0.5 ℓ), non-smoker group(4.32±0.9 ℓ).<BR> 10. ERV appeared in order of smoker group(l.80±0.4 ℓ), non-smoker group(2.09±0.3 ℓ).<BR> 11. IC appeared in order of smoker group(3.00±0.2 ℓ), non-smoker group(3.51±0.3 ℓ).<BR> 12. TV appeared in order of smoker group(0.72±0.2 ㎖), non-smoker group(0.88±0.1 ㎖).<BR> 13. IRV appeared in order of smoker group(2.28±0.1 ℓ). non-smoker group(2.63±0.2 ℓ).
